Decided to prep car for winter by replacing new radiator and coolant and a new battery. On installing battery connected ground terminal first and then positive. (Oops) While tightening positive post there was a split second short to ground, didn't think it was a big deal until I turned the key-switch ... NOTHING.. After two frustrating days I then installed a starter switch under hood from positive to purple wire on starter. On initial check engine turn over OK. Then connected Red and Pink under dash for constant feed. Pushed starter button, engine starts instantly, drove 5 mniles home flawlessly.
NEXT.. replaced suspected ignition switch, steering wheel removal etc. New switch rending exact same response - nothing,
However, now clock stays on, radio can be turned on without key assistance 🙂blink🙂 . HELP!! Is there a starter relay?? Where??
Car has 70K miles still acts and run new, all original trims still.
